Output 7950fbcdcfdfaf08d3b078caee6120aa76bce85748c4dfd9a6d761469f8aac28:0

value
400820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26ce2ac211097af981670376e2939a2a32acdc5 OP_EQUAL
address
3LseGKaM8i6JMRYx4f8iZiMwFzdbphZBHy
transaction
7950fbcdcfdfaf08d3b078caee6120aa76bce85748c4dfd9a6d761469f8aac28
confirmations
148884
spent
true